Number Plate Test

When you drive you must be able to check out a number plate (with glasses or restorative lenses if needed) at a distance of 20.5 metres (67 feet). If you can refrain from doing this you are not fit to drive.

The DVLA has actually released a new campaign to remind drivers that the law needs them to be able to check out a basic size number plate in good daytime from 20 metres away. It's an easy test that anybody can self administer to examine their eyesight. If they have any concerns they need to visit their optician and organize a full eye test.

DVLA research reveals that less than half of the drivers it surveyed understood that they needed to be able to check out a number plate at a legal distance of 20 metres. 5 automobile lengths is the equivalent of this distance. The DVLA has actually been motivating drivers to use this as a basic way to inspect their vision, especially as lots of people will not be having a regular eye test since of the pandemic.

At the start of a useful driving test the inspector will ask you to correctly read a number plate on a parked lorry that is around 20 metres away. If you are not able to do this you will fail your driving test. Those that need glasses to do this will have to use them when they take the test and they need to inform the examiner about their need for glasses.

Goldmann Perimetry Test

The Goldmann Perimetry Test is a visual field examination used to assess the quality of peripheral vision. It is often used to identify glaucoma and other neurological illness. It uses either handbook (Goldmann perimetry) or computer-driven automated techniques (Humphrey and Octopus perimetry). The Goldmann test can also be utilized to figure out the intensity of an eye condition such as a removed retina.

The test includes a patient sitting in front of a round bowl consisting of a fixation target. The inspector shines a light onto the target, then moves it around a set border. The patient is asked to suggest whether they can see the light. The perimetry device records the actions, making it possible to create a specific map of the visual field.

The test outcomes are then compared with those of the DVLA's minimum standards for drivers. For a group 1 licence (for vehicles and motorbikes), the DVLA needs a binocular visual field of at least 120 degrees horizontally and 30 degrees vertically. This should be without flaws that might impair driving.

Esterman Test

The Esterman test is a beneficial tool in the medical diagnosis of various eye conditions, including glaucoma and optic nerve illness. Its systematic method permits for an extensive examination of visual field patterns, adding to precise medical diagnoses and efficient treatment strategies. The test is a good indicator of the intensity and extent of a patient's visual loss. The existence of arcuate scotomas, for example, is extremely suggestive of glaucoma. Other patterns of visual field loss can likewise show a variety of conditions, such as optic neuritis and retinal diseases.

The test includes a series of grids and a computer that tape-records the responses of the subject's eyes as they move across the screen.
